#9804d1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9804d1 is composed of 59.6% red, 1.6%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.3% cyan, 98.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 283.3 degrees, a saturation of 96.2% and a lightness of 41.8%. #9804d1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ff08ff with #3100a3. Closest websafe color is: #9900cc.

#9804d1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9804d1 has RGB values of R:152, G:4, B:209 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 9962705.
